基于查找表的高阶掩码研究及其VLSI硬件实现

基于查找表的高阶掩码研究及其VLSI硬件实现

ID:37045662

大小:1.09 MB

页数:67页

时间:2019-05-17

基于查找表的高阶掩码研究及其VLSI硬件实现_第1页
基于查找表的高阶掩码研究及其VLSI硬件实现_第2页
基于查找表的高阶掩码研究及其VLSI硬件实现_第3页
基于查找表的高阶掩码研究及其VLSI硬件实现_第4页
基于查找表的高阶掩码研究及其VLSI硬件实现_第5页
资源描述:

《基于查找表的高阶掩码研究及其VLSI硬件实现》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、理学硕士学位论文基于查找表的高阶掩码研究及其VLSI硬件实现厚娇哈尔滨理工大学2018年3月国内图书分类号:TP309.2理学硕士学位论文基于查找表的高阶掩码研究及其VLSI硬件实现硕士研究生:厚娇导师:姜久兴教授申请学位级别:理学硕士学科、专业:物理学所在单位:理学院答辩日期:2018年3月授予学位单位:哈尔滨理工大学ClassifiedIndex:TP309.2DissertationfortheMasterDegreeinScienceResearchonLook-upTableBasedHigher-OrderMaskingSchemeandVLSIHardwareImplementa

2、tionCandidate:HouJiaoSupervisor:Prof.JiangJiuxingAcademicDegreeAppliedfor:MasterofScienceSpecialty:PhysicsDateofOralExamination:March,2018HarbinUniversityofScienceandUniversity:Technology哈尔滨理工大学硕士学位论文原创性声明本人郑重声明:此处所提交的硕士学位论文《基于查找表的高阶掩码研究及其VLSI硬件实现》,是本人在导师指导下,在哈尔滨理工大学攻读硕士学位期间独立进行研究工作所取得的成果。据本人所知,论文中

3、除已注明部分外不包含他人已发表或撰写过的研究成果。对本文研究工作做出贡献的个人和集体,均已在文中以明确方式注明。本声明的法律结果将完全由本人承担。作者签名:厚娇日期:2018年3月29日哈尔滨理工大学硕士学位论文使用授权书《基于查找表的高阶掩码研究及其VLSI硬件实现》系本人在哈尔滨理工大学攻读硕士学位期间在导师指导下完成的硕士学位论文。本论文的研究成果归哈尔滨理工大学所有,本论文的研究内容不得以其它单位的名义发表。本人完全了解哈尔滨理工大学关于保存、使用学位论文的规定,同意学校保留并向有关部门提交论文和电子版本,允许论文被查阅和借阅。本人授权哈尔滨理工大学可以采用影印、缩印或其他复制手段保存

4、论文,可以公布论文的全部或部分内容。本学位论文属于保密□,在年解密后适用授权书。不保密。(请在以上相应方框内打√)作者签名:厚娇日期:2018年3月29日导师签名:姜久兴日期:2018年3月29日基于查找表的高阶掩码研究及其VLSI硬件实现摘要高级加密标准(AdvancedEncryptionStandard,AES)具有较好的安全性、效率和灵活性等特点,被广泛应用于信息安全领域。侧信道攻击技术(Side-ChannelAttacks,SCA)的出现对其硬件安全构成了巨大威胁,特别是高阶差分功耗攻击对加密芯片的安全性构成的威胁最大。为了抵御侧信道攻击技术,掩码(一阶和高价掩码)是一种通用而有

5、效的方法。然而,现有的抗功耗攻击的方法都是以牺牲芯片的性能和面积为代价的,在基于查找表的掩码方案中,循环移位S盒掩码方案(RotatingS-BoxMasking,RSM)方案相比于其他方案有较好的安全性和性能,是一个安全性和性能的折中方案。但对于一些面积受限或者对安全性要求高的设备,RSM方案就很难应用到实际中去。因此,如何在提高安全性的同时减少由此带来的性能和面积开销成为抗侧信道攻击领域亟待解决的问题。本文以基于查找表的掩码方案为研究对象,深入分析分组密码S盒的特点,以切实降低掩码复杂度为目的,研究基于查找表的低熵高阶掩码方案。具体工作如下:(1)分析了Nassar等人提出的RSM掩码方案

6、的掩码原理及其局限性,提出了一种低面积复杂度的通用低熵掩码方案,其核心思想是在现有RSM的基础上,采用S盒共用思想降低加密算法的面积复杂度。(2)将所提出的S盒共用掩码方案应用到AES算法上,使其掩码S盒的数量从16个降低为4个(没有考虑密钥扩展操作)。为了提高AES加密算法上的吞吐量,对AES的整体架构进行了流水线设计,提高了算法的执行效率。对于128位的加密数据而言,本设计需要91个时钟周期实现4个128位数据的加密过程,相比于非流水线实现,其加速比为3.47。(3)为了提高系统的安全性,本文采用了乱序(Shuffle)技术,有效解决了RSM方案不能够抵御基于偏移量CPA攻击的问题。采用V

7、erilogHDL对所提出的方案进行建模,采用IntelAltera综合工具进行综合,结果显示S盒共用方案使用的组合逻辑为RSM方案的31%,时序逻辑为RSM方案的40%,存储位为RSM方案的20%。(4)为了评估所设计方案的硬件复杂度,采用SMIC180nm标准工艺库,-I-使用Synopsys公司的DC(DesignCompiler)综合工具进行综合,使用后端工具SOC_encounter进行

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。